    Today is allowance day! As you may have read in my earlier post, every Monday I give myself a cash allowance. Sometimes I've gotten as much as $200 a week or as little as $50. My current weekly allowance (dictated by my budget) is $60 a week.

    Do you want an allowance too? Here are some quick steps to help you calculate how much your weekly allowance should be.

    1) Add up all your MONTHLY non-cash expenses (bills, savings, investments)
    2) Subtract your non-cash expenses from your MONTHLY take-home pay. (The amount left over is your monthly cash allowance.)
    3) Divide your monthly cash allowance by 4 (weeks) (This amount is your weekly cash allowance)
    4) Use your cash allowance to pay for items you could and should pay cash for (groceries, gas, toiletries, clothes, grooming, eating out, entertainment etc.)
    5) Pick a day of the week when you'll take your allowance. (mine is Monday)
    6) On that day, take out any left over allowance and put it in a jar/drawer/envelope. Save this money and use as you wish! (vacations, spa, shopping spree, home remodeling)
    7) Also on that day, go to the bank/ATM and withdraw your allowance for the week.
    8) Spend guilt-free because your bills, savings and investments are already taken care of!

    (tip: I make sure my allowance is in multiples of twenty dollars, is make it easier to get it from any ATM)
